Factors to Consider When Choosing Foldable Electric Pianos with 88 Keys

When choosing a foldable electric piano with 88 keys, I consider factors like portability, key feel, sound quality, connectivity, and battery life. These aspects directly impact how well the instrument suits my playing style and mobility needs. Understanding each point helps me find the best fit for both practice and performance.
Portability and Weight
Portability and weight are crucial factors when selecting a foldable electric piano with 88 keys, especially if you plan to take it on the go. Lighter models, typically weighing between 5 to 15 pounds, are much easier to carry around, whether you’re heading to lessons, practice sessions, or outdoor gigs. Compact folded dimensions, often under 25 inches, help the piano fit into backpacks, travel bags, or overhead compartments, making transportation seamless. Including a padded carrying case or tote adds extra protection and convenience. A one-button folding mechanism or simple hinge design allows for quick setup and disassembly, saving time and effort. Ultimately, a lightweight, compact design enhances usability across various scenarios, making your musical journey more flexible and stress-free.
Key Feel and Action
Choosing the right key feel is essential because it directly affects how natural and expressive your playing will be on a foldable electric piano. The key action—whether semi-weighted, weighted, or non-weighted—shapes your tactile feedback and responsiveness. Fully weighted keys mimic acoustic pianos, offering resistance that helps develop proper finger strength and control, making your playing more realistic. Semi-weighted keys strike a balance, providing a lighter feel suited for players shifting from beginner to intermediate. Non-weighted keys, often toy-like, lack the tactile feedback necessary for proper technique, which can hinder progress. Responsiveness, including velocity sensitivity and rebound, is also vital for expressiveness. Overall, choosing an action that aligns with your skill level and playing style will enhance your performance and enjoyment.
Sound Quality and Tones
The sound quality and variety of tones on a foldable electric piano can substantially influence your playing experience. The realism of the sound depends on the sampling method and the quality of the built-in speakers—higher-end models deliver more authentic piano tones. A broad range of voices, like grand piano, electric piano, strings, and organs, boosts versatility and creative expression. Tones that are multi-layered and customizable allow for dynamic performances and nuanced sound variations. The number of available voices and accompaniment styles, such as 128 each, expands your musical possibilities across genres. Additionally, external audio outputs like headphone jacks and line outs are indispensable for high-quality sound reproduction and seamless integration with external speakers or recording gear.

Battery Life and Power
Long battery life is essential when selecting a foldable electric piano with 88 keys, especially if you plan to practice or perform on the go. A battery that lasts 8 to 12 hours means fewer interruptions and more uninterrupted playing sessions. The capacity and type, like lithium-ion batteries, directly impact how long your piano can operate without recharging. Some models let you switch seamlessly between battery power and AC, giving you flexibility for portable or stationary use. Recharging times vary from about 2 to 5 hours, so quick recharges are a plus. Additionally, features like power-saving modes help extend battery life during extended practice or gigs. Prioritizing these aspects guarantees you’re always ready to perform, whether at home or on the move.
